Abstract

Image Ecologies draws from the expanded field of photographic practice to present new understandings of material, economic and ecological entanglements.

The work reflects on the capacity of regional and remote communities adapt to social, cultural, political and ecological change. These small, often overlooked communities are a microcosm for the study of broader impacts that can be expected on a global scale as Western Culture moves further into the unknown era of the Anthropocene.
